Garden Guru Hacks:

  1. Seed Starter Pots: Gently crack an eggshell in half, clean it out, and fill it with potting mix to create eco-friendly seed starter pots. Once the seedlings outgrow the eggshells, plant them directly in the ground – eggshell and all! The calcium will benefit the growing plants.
  2. Slug Stopper: The sharp edges of crushed eggshells can deter pesky slugs and snails from munching on your precious plants. Sprinkle crushed eggshells around the base of your plants.
  3. Compost Calcium Boost: Eggshells are a great addition to your compost pile, adding essential calcium for healthy plant growth.
